    Hah... I'm working on a project at work -- it's a headphone amplifier. The specification states a certain chipset to be used -- in order to achieve ~0.000003% THD+N. I have to follow the customer's specification, but that kind of figure is insane. Research shows that the majority of people cannot hear beyond 1% and the limit is 0.1% for essentially everyone. But, the audiophools will buy it!
